Why Glass Repair is Essential

Glass repair ought to not be overlooked due to its essential function in keeping security and structural stability. Broken or damaged glass can pose a number of risks, consisting of:

  • Safety Hazards: Sharp edges can cause major injuries.
  • Structural Issues: Damaged glass can jeopardize the stability of structures.
  • Energy Inefficiency: Cracks and breaks can cause significant heat loss or gain, impacting energy bills.
  • Aesthetic Concerns: Damaged glass can interfere with the overall look of a property, reducing its market value.

Provided these implications, timely and professional glass repair is crucial for both residential and commercial homes.

Selecting a Reputable Glass Repair Service

Selecting the right glass repair service can be overwhelming, especially with numerous options available. Here are some suggested actions to ensure that you select a reliable company:

1. Examine Credentials

  • Guarantee the company is licensed and insured.
  • Look for reviews and reviews from previous consumers.

2. Ask About Experience

  • Inquire about the service technicians' experience and training in glass repair.
  • A strong track record in the neighborhood can indicate reliability.

3. Obtain Multiple Quotes

  • Request quotes from a number of business to understand market rates.
  • Beware of rates that seem too excellent to be real; they often are.

4. Inquire About Warranties

  • A reputable service must offer warranties for both the labor and products utilized.
  • Confirm what the warranty covers and its period.

5. Examine Customer Service

  • Engage with the company to determine their responsiveness and willingness to answer concerns.
  • Great consumer service is often reflective of the quality of work supplied.
Cost Factors in Glass Repair

Understanding the costs related to glass repair can prepare you for the monetary aspect of your project. Elements influencing the price may consist of:

Cost FactorsDescriptionType of GlassTempered glass typically costs more than standard glass.Size of the RepairLarger panes or numerous windows will increase expenses.Extent of DamageMinor chips might cost less to repair than big fractures or complete replacements.AreaEveryday service charge might differ by region.Extra ServicesAdditional costs may develop from removal or installation services.

Common Cost Ranges

  • Window Repair: ₤ 150 to ₤ 600
  • Automobile Glass Repair: ₤ 100 to ₤ 400
  • Shower Door Replacement: ₤ 200 to ₤ 800
  • Glass Tabletop Repair: ₤ 100 to ₤ 300

These expenses can fluctuate based on the specifics of the job, emphasizing the requirement for estimates tailored to private situations.

FAQs About Glass Repair

1. How long does it typically take to repair glass?

The time required can differ based on the kind of repair. Small automobile glass repairs might take an hour, while window replacements could take a couple of hours.

2. Is glass repair covered by homeowners' insurance?

Numerous homeowners' insurance coverage cover glass damage. It is a good idea to consult your insurer about the specifics of your policy.

3. Can I repair cracked glass myself?

While small chips can sometimes be sealed with DIY kits, professional repair is suggested for security and quality assurance.

4. What should I do if there's an extreme crack in my glass?

If the glass poses a risk (like in windows or windscreens), avoid utilizing it and contact a professional repair service immediately.
